Aram B. Movaseghi

ARAM B. MOVASEGHI is Of Counsel with the Firm’s Fidelity, Construction, and Surety Group and he concentrates his practice in the areas of construction litigation, surety and fidelity litigation, and bankruptcy law. He represents his clients in state and federal courts as well as in arbitration, mediation and other ADR proceedings. Aram’s representative clients include public and private owners, general contractors, subcontractors, sureties, and individuals in a variety of matters.

Mr. Movaseghi's surety experience includes performance bond defaults, contractor transactions, bankruptcies, payment bond claims, liens, and wage and hour claims, among other matters. In his construction practice, Aram assists construction clients with lien, contract, defective work, wage and hour, and bid protests, among other matters. In addition, Aram handles landlord-tenant matters, handling eviction matters in the state of New York.

Mr. Movaseghi is admitted to practice in the State of New York, the State of New Jersey, the U.S. District Court for the Eastern District of New York, and the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of New York. Aram has represented clients in a number of states pro hac vice.

Mr. Movaseghi graduated from Stony Brook University with a Bachelor of Arts degree in Economics in 2016. He received his Juris Doctor from St. John’s University School of Law in 2020. Prior to joining the firm, Mr. Movaseghi served as a judicial law clerk to the Honorable Douglas E. Arpert U.S.M.J. (Ret.), District of New Jersey.
